The soccer jersey has evolved significantly over the years, transforming from a simple piece of athletic wear to a powerful symbol of team identity and national pride. In recent times, soccer jersey design has not only focused on functionality but has also merged with the world of fashion, creating unique and eye-catching designs that captivate fans and players alike.

Gone are the days when soccer jerseys were just plain shirts with the team’s logo. Today, jersey designers have embraced an amalgamation of fashion and function, using innovative techniques and materials to produce stunning creations that not only perform on the field but also make a bold fashion statement.

One of the key elements of modern jersey design is the use of cutting-edge technology and performance fabrics. Gone are the heavy and uncomfortable cotton jerseys of the past. Instead, teams now turn to lightweight fabrics that stretch and breathe with the player’s movements, allowing for maximum comfort and flexibility on the pitch. These fabrics are not only functional but are often adorned with intricate patterns, designs, and vibrant colors that catch the eye.

Another aspect that sets apart modern soccer jersey design is the unique incorporation of team identity and national symbolism. Designers have become adept at creating jerseys that capture the essence of a team or country, telling a story and evoking a sense of national pride. Take, for example, the Dutch national team’s bright orange jerseys, symbolizing the country’s heritage as the birthplace of the House of Orange. Or the iconic yellow and green jersey of the Brazilian national team, representing the vibrant colors of the country’s flag.

Beyond national symbolism, jersey design has also embraced elements of fashion and popular culture. Some teams have collaborated with renowned fashion designers, creating limited-edition jerseys that blur the lines between sports and high fashion. These collaborations often result in jerseys that are not only functional but also stylish, drawing attention on and off the pitch.

Additionally, typography and graphic design play a vital role in the art of soccer jersey design. The team’s name and logo are often rendered in bold and unique fonts, creating an instantly recognizable visual identity. Creative graphic elements, such as subtle patterns or gradients, are incorporated to add a touch of modernity and visual interest. All these aspects contribute to the overall aesthetic appeal of the jersey.

The art of soccer jersey design is not limited to professional teams or national squads. It has also permeated grassroots soccer, with amateur and youth teams embracing the idea of custom-designed jerseys that reflect their unique identity. Online platforms have made it easier than ever for teams to create their own jerseys, allowing for even greater creativity and customization.

In conclusion, soccer jersey design has transformed into an art form that merges fashion and function in a remarkable way. The incorporation of innovative technology, performance fabrics, and stylish design elements has revolutionized the concept of the traditional soccer jersey. With each new season, fans eagerly anticipate the unveiling of their team’s new jersey, eager to see what unique design and story will be captured on the fabric. Soccer jerseys have become a canvas for creativity and expression, capturing the essence of the sport and its cultural significance.
